WXY Named Finalist Twice for PORCH: An Architecture of Generosity at the 2025 Venice Biennale
WXY Named Finalist Twice for PORCH: An Architecture of Generosity at the 2025 Venice Biennale

We’re excited to share that WXY has been selected twice as a finalist for PORCH: An Architecture of Generosity, the U.S. Pavilion exhibition at the 19th International Architecture Exhibition of La Biennale di Venezia. The exhibition is organized by the Fay Jones School of Architecture and Design at the University of Arkansas in collaboration with DesignConnects and Crystal Bridges Museum of American Art.

WXY had two submissions accepted. The first is Coastal Porchscapes, developed in collaboration with NYC Parks, and L+M Development Partners LLC. The second was with the New York City Department of Transportation on Dining Out NYC. Both submissions were selected as finalists. The exhibition explores themes of civic engagement, community building, and social and environmental resilience through architecture and design. As part of the U.S. Pavilion, WXY’s work will contribute to a global conversation on how architecture can foster generosity, connection, and cultural exchange.
